Crafting Tailored Fitness Solutions

One size does not fit all when it comes to catering to wealthy investors. Personalization is key. Begin by conducting in-depth consultations to understand their fitness goals, preferences, and any specific requirements they may have. Perhaps they’re recovering from an injury and need specialized rehabilitation exercises, or maybe they’re training for a triathlon and require a comprehensive performance program. By tailoring your fitness solutions to their individual needs, you demonstrate your commitment to their success.

Offering Convenience and Flexibility

Wealthy investors lead busy lives, juggling multiple commitments and responsibilities. Offer flexible scheduling options to accommodate their hectic schedules, whether it’s early morning sessions before they start their day or late evening workouts after business hours. Consider offering concierge services such as at-home training sessions or virtual coaching for those who travel frequently. By prioritizing convenience and flexibility, you make it easier for them to prioritize their fitness goals amidst their busy lifestyle.
